Nearly 1,000 COVID-19 vaccination doses were delivered in Buckinghamshire by the Health on the Move van in November – and more are on the way. The vaccination van returns again to Bucks from Monday, 6 December, and will visit High Wycombe, Chesham, Gerrards Cross and Buckingham, with more stops to be …

Immunizations are an … WebApr 10, 2024 · Around a million people in the North East and Yorkshire are now eligible for a spring covid jab, including over 75s, those with a weakened immune system and older adult care home residents. Those living in care homes are being prioritised and begin to receive vaccinations from Monday (3rd April) as roving NHS teams visit homes to offer protection.
